  • Day 5 Wednesday South Ari To Central Ari Atoll
  • With the depth of around 12 to 16 meters, Panathone is a famous manta site with high possibility of manta feed sighting outside the atoll during outgoing current. During incoming currents on the ridge of the atoll, youll see what is known as the Shark City and dozens of big grey reef sharks mesmerizing your every thought and after dozens of dives our staff will invite you a BBQ dinner
  • Dive 1:  Rangali Manta, Dive 2:  Rai Dhiga, Dive 3:  Panathone

  • Day 6 Thursday Close To Equator Line & Fuvahmulah
  • Fuvahmulah is one of the main highlights in a Deep South trip. Quality of the diving isnt affected by the seasonal changes. As each and every dive is equally unique and a challenging experience. The real treasure you could find in this area is the Thresher Shark. However, other shark species such as Reef Sharks, Tiger Sharks, Hammerheads and Silver Tips also resides in the location. And if you are just lucky enough, you might spot the worlds heaviest bony fish MOLA MOLAS. The list is really endless.

Hanifaru Bay

Hanifaru Bay is a marine protected uninhabited island located in the Baa Atoll of the Maldives Islands. Its size is no greater than that of a football field and yet it has become one of the hottest spots for underwater photographers. The reason for this modern day phenomenon of underwater diversity is because plankton blooms between the months of May and November a very unusual phenomenon attracting manta rays by the hundreds. At any one time at Hanifaru Bay, there can be up to 200 manta rays feeding off the coral reefs as well as plenty of whale sharks which do the same! Hanifaru Bay has become the worlds largest manta ray feeding destinations.

PLEASE NOTE: From January 2012 scuba diving is not permitted in Hanifaru Bay, however you will be able to snorkel in this area for a $20 fee (per person for approx. 45mins).
